Understanding the Core Mechanics of Plinko
At its heart, plinko is a vertical board featuring a series of pegs. A player releases a disc or ball from the top, and as it descends, it bounces randomly off the pegs. The ball ultimately lands in one of several slots at the bottom of the board, each assigned a different payout multiplier. The potential payout depends entirely on where the ball lands. The game’s core lies in its dependence on unpredictable bounces, fostering a sense of anticipation and excitement with each drop.

The Role of Physics in Plinko Gameplay
Though appearing purely random, the movement of the ball in plinko is governed by fundamental principles of physics – primarily gravity, momentum, and the angle of incidence. The angle at which the ball hits a peg dictates the angle at which it rebounds. While predicting the precise trajectory after numerous collisions is exceptionally difficult, understanding these principles can offer insights into potential outcomes. Factors such as the ball’s material and the pegs’ size and placement contribute to the complexity of the system.
Impact of Peg Density on Ball Trajectory
The density of pegs dramatically affects the randomness of the game. A board with closely spaced pegs results in a higher number of collisions, leading to a more chaotic and unpredictable trajectory. In contrast, a sparser arrangement of pegs allows for longer, more direct paths, potentially making it easier to anticipate, albeit within a limited scope, where the ball might land. Players can often observe subtle patterns emerge within numerous game cycles, but these patterns tend to be relatively short-lived due to the inherent randomness of the system. This observation is crucial, as players who focus solely on fleeting trends may find themselves falling prey to the gambler’s fallacy – the mistaken belief that past outcomes influence future results.

Betting Strategies and Risk Management
Effective plinko gameplay extends beyond understanding the physics; it requires strategic betting and meticulous risk management. Players vary their approach, ranging from conservative strategies focusing on lower payout multipliers with higher probabilities to aggressive tactics aiming for the largest jackpots. Adapting a strategy based on a player’s risk tolerance and bankroll is paramount. Employing a structured betting system, rather than relying on impulse bets, can help manage funds and prolong playing time.
- Fixed Stake Strategy: Betting the same amount on each drop, aiming for consistent, smaller wins.
- Martingale Strategy (Caution Advised): Doubling the bet after each loss, seeking to recover previous losses with a single win.
- Fibonacci Strategy: Adjusting bets based on the Fibonacci sequence (1, 1, 2, 3, 5, 8…) to manage risk.
While these strategies can be employed, it’s crucial to remember that plinko is fundamentally a game of chance. No strategy can guarantee consistent profits.
